FAQ: Why does the Wrenlet client reconnect-storm after a deploy? Short answer: the websocket layer retries with zero jitter, so every client hammers the gateway at once. Reviewer note — the fix in this PR adds exponential backoff plus a resume token; please check the token isn't logged anywhere. To replay the repro against the staging gateway you'll need its vault unlocked, and the recovery passphrase for that sits directly below.

unlock words, yawig-kagef: gordor-holvan-ulaael-pramir-ulaiel-tamdor

## Step 3: Move digest scheduling to Driftmail

Digest batching now runs through the Driftmail scheduler instead of cron. Disable the old crontab entry first. Each tenant's send window is computed from its timezone; do not hardcode UTC offsets. Run the backfill once, verify the queue drains, then enable the recurring trigger. The scheduler reads the following configuration at startup.

config for hahip-kaguf:
[holath]
port = 8443
region = north-4
host = holath.tolvaqlabs.internal
timeout_ms = 1000
retries = 2

MINUTES — Management Meeting, Sales Leads

Attendees reviewed churn figures for the Skylark pilot programme run by Orville & Trent. Of the forty pilot accounts, nine lapsed in the second month, mostly citing onboarding friction rather than price. Marnie Falk will redesign the welcome sequence; Dev Okoro will call the lapsed accounts personally. The group agreed to pause new pilot enrolments until retention stabilises. Next review in three weeks. The chair closed with a note on wider direction, recorded below.

confidential, tagag-kahof: Rusathox Partners plans to lower the Gorox list price by 63 percent in December.